Breffni Plant Hire raises the bar

An all encompassing list of modern plant and machinery, competitive pricing, unrivalled levels of customer service and an ability to move with the times have been the cornerstones of Breffni Plant Hire Ltd’s success for more than three decades.

Part of the fleet

Sean and Annette Flynn, of Leitrim and Cavan respectively established the appropriately named Breffni Plant Hire Ltd in 1971. Down through the years, the company has built up an impressive customer list in both the public and private sectors.

Nowadays the company works for the various county councils in Dublin and surrounding counties as well as Iarnrod Eireann, the Office of Public Works and a host of building and civil engineering contractors throughout the country.

While the bulk of the company’s work would be located in the greater Dublin area, Breffni Plant Hire is ready, willing and able to carry out projects throughout Ireland.

The company is involved in a myriad of activities including plant hire, site clearance, landscaping, construction, demolition and rail works.
Like many of its peers in the plant hire sector, part of Breffni Plant Hire’s success can be attributed to the boom in the construction sector in Dublin since the early 1990s. However, the company played a huge part in moulding its own destiny.

The company has been able to expand into numerous areas that can all be pulled in under the loose heading of plant hire. Of equal importance is the fact that this expansion has been achieved while complying with all relevant legislation governing the various sector the company has entered.

Another vital ingredient in the company’s success is it staff, which number upwards on 70 people. Breffni Plant Hire prides itself on having a relatively low turnover of staff. “A lot of the staff have been between 10 and 15 years service with the company, while many more would be with us for at least five years. We feel our staff are one of our biggest assets,” Sean explained.

Throughout the company from administration to machine and lorry operators to general operatives, Breffni Plant Hire has an experienced, well trained and customer friendly staff intent on delivering high levels of customer service. “All our staff are equally important to us. They are all part of the same chain leading to a successful company and they have important roles to play with in the company,” he added.
To facilitate the smooth running of operations, the company utilises an extensive list of plant and machinery comprising of artic and tipper trucks, track and mobile excavators, dozers and dump trucks along with a range of smaller plant items.

Right across the company’s entire plant and machinery list, Breffni Plant Hire has a mixture of new equipment, which is complemented by well-maintained older stock. “You can’t replace every machine every year, which means you will have a certain amount of older equipment. Having said that we are constantly upgrading our equipment,” Sean revealed.

“The advantage of running modern equipment is that you don’t have breakdowns. Downtime in this business is crucial. Many of our machines would be working in tandem with each other. You just could not afford to have labour and machinery idle for a lengthy duration because one machine is broken-down on a particular site,” he added.

In order to keep the fleet in tip-top condition, the company has a well-apportioned workshop in North Dublin where an experienced crew of fitters along with Service Manager Ken maintain the entire plant and machinery stock. Much of the work the fitters undertake would be preventative maintenance.

The workshop crew’s lot is made that little bit easier by virtue of the fact that the company carries a spare machine in each category be that a tipper truck, track and mobile excavator, dozer or dump truck. “That means our fitters can take a machine in and give it the once over before any such breakdown can occur,” Sean added.

Sean is acutely aware that maintenance and repairs are costly, whether they are conducted “In house” or by a third party. But the company’s excellent preventative maintenance programme means breakdowns are the exeption rather than the norm. “In the unlikely event of a breakdown we can provide a replacement machine to any site with the utmost efficiency, which makes for peace of mind,” he remarked.

Since the turn of the last century, companies working in the construction sector reported a general slowdown in the industry however this has not adversely affected Breffni Plant Hire. “That is down to our reputation for giving high levels of service using quality plant and equipment manned by experienced staff. Price will always be an important consideration, with our rates being extremely competitive however a quality service is as important within the construction industry in the 21st century,” he commented.

Sean concluded: “In the construction industry if your not going forward your falling backwards and you can fall behind in a matter of weeks, not years. So you have to be flexible and move with the times. In that respect we are continually looking to the future.”
